I am very pleased to offer this amendment with my colleagues, two great women, Representative Jan Schakowsky and Representative Yvette Clarke. Our amendment is very simple. It would strike a provision in this bill that applies to any policy riders included in the annual Labor, Health and Human Services and Agricultural appropriations bills to the new National Institutes of Health funds and the Federal Drug Administration funds included in H.R. 6, the 21st Century Cures Act. This provision reiterates the current law restrictions on appropriations bills, like the Hyde amendment, which is restrictive and discriminatory against low-income women to make their own reproductive healthcare decisions. Now this would apply to this new fund created for the NIH in this bill. Let's be clear what this is really about. It is yet another attempt to insert abortion restrictions and other inappropriate riders into an unrelated bill. This is a bill to increase biomedical innovative research. The 21st Century Cures Act should have been a noncontroversial, bipartisan effort. But anti-choice leaders could not help but add this to the bill after--mind you, after--it had passed out of committee on a bipartisan vote. It is really outrageous and part of a larger effort to force the inclusion of these harmful Hyde restrictions in multiple and unrelated bills. We know that these dangerous policies disproportionately affect low- income women and women of color.…
